LONDON.- The UK’s longest-running and most prestigious artists’ collective, The London Group, announces the 70 members who will be exhibiting in the 82nd London Group Open:

The London Group members listed will exhibit their work alongside at least 70 non member artists selected from the open call. The selected non-member artists will be announced in early September 2015, with all works being displayed across two exhibitions at The Cello Factory, London from 13 - 23 October and 27 October - 6 November 2015.

The exhibition provides a wonderful opportunity for emerging and established artists to raise their profile, win cash and material prizes, and exhibit their work to the public alongside the Group’s esteemed members. Carefully picked by The London Group Selection Committee, consisting of existing member artists, this truly is an exhibition of art chosen by artists.

The 82nd exhibition will be dedicated to former London Group member, Albert Irvin OBE RA, who sadly passed away this year. Albert was a member of the Group for 50 years. His work will additionally be on display during both parts of the exhibition.

In recognition of today’s increasingly diversified art scene, the exhibition will feature works in a large range of mediums, including painting, sculpture, drawing, print, photography, digital, mixed media, installation, and video.

A selection of generous awards will be presented at a Prize Giving event on 6th November. The prizes include a three-person exhibition at The Cello Factory, and the Ingram Collection of Modern British & Contemporary Art purchase prize. Included within the £5000 prize fund is the Chelsea Arts Club Trust Stan Smith Award for an artist under 35 (£1,500), a sculpture prize awarded by Jeff Lowe (£500), the GX Gallery Annual prize (£300), and the Worshipful Company of Painter-Stainers Prize for Drawing (£300). Material prizes include the Winsor & Newton Materials Prize for Painting and Drawing (£500), and £300 worth of photographic services from Patrick Gorman.

Two artists’ talks with some of the exhibiting artists will take place on 19th October and 2nd November 2015.
